Face Mask
 
Looking for opinions on the editorial change re: face masks (3-5-2). It states that face masks must be worn "molded to the face". Sat night BV we had a player who had a face mask that was molded, ie "shaped" to his face, however, there was a pad of approximately 1/2 in that went all around the mask between it and his face so it sort of sat off the face a bit. There were no protrusions/edges to the mask and we didn't deem it dangerous so we let him play with it. Has anyone seen a picture of an illegal mask? Thanks...

The illegal mask is something that looks sort of like a football face mask.

What you describe is legal.

NCAA: Incidental face masks (grab and release) have been eliminated. Only facemasks that are a personal foul (grab and pull or twist) are illegal.

NFHS: The incidental face mask is still illegal in addition to the personal foul variety.
